To display details about an automation execution
The following
get-automation-execution
example displays detailed information about an Automation execution.aws ssm get-automation-execution \ --automation-execution-id
73c8eef8-f4ee-4a05-820c-e354fEXAMPLE
Output:
{ "AutomationExecution": { "AutomationExecutionId": "73c8eef8-f4ee-4a05-820c-e354fEXAMPLE", "DocumentName": "AWS-StartEC2Instance", "DocumentVersion": "1", "ExecutionStartTime": 1583737233.748, "ExecutionEndTime": 1583737234.719, "AutomationExecutionStatus": "Success", "StepExecutions": [ { "StepName": "startInstances", "Action": "aws:changeInstanceState", "ExecutionStartTime": 1583737234.134, "ExecutionEndTime": 1583737234.672, "StepStatus": "Success", "Inputs": { "DesiredState": "\"running\"", "InstanceIds": "[\"i-0cb99161f6EXAMPLE\"]" }, "Outputs": { "InstanceStates": [ "running" ] }, "StepExecutionId": "95e70479-cf20-4d80-8018-7e4e2EXAMPLE", "OverriddenParameters": {} } ], "StepExecutionsTruncated": false, "Parameters": { "AutomationAssumeRole": [ "" ], "InstanceId": [ "i-0cb99161f6EXAMPLE" ] }, "Outputs": {}, "Mode": "Auto", "ExecutedBy": "arn:aws:sts::29884EXAMPLE:assumed-role/mw_service_role/OrchestrationService", "Targets": [], "ResolvedTargets": { "ParameterValues": [], "Truncated": false } } }
